我尝试使用这个简单的实现来替换缩略图库中任何选定图像的图像。当我使用.load()函数并替换我当前名为"替换"的当前div类时,会出现问题。有一个新的div,如纽约,有一个画廊。替换图库后,第一个功能不再有效。
<script>
$('.replace #thumbs img').click(function(){
$('#largeImage').attr('src',$(this).attr('src').replace('thumb', 'large'));
});
</script>
<script>
$(document).ready(function() {
$( ".NYC" ).click(function() {
$(".replace").load("Galleries.html #NYC");
});
});
</script>
答案 0 :(得分:0)
使用jquery来注册您的第一次点击,例如:
<script>
$('.replace').on('click', '#thumbs img', function(){
$('#largeImage').attr('src',$(this).attr('src').replace('thumb', 'large'));
});
</script>